kikiontheriver


Member since 10/22/2017

Name: Kiki on the River

kikiontheriver

Location: Miami, FL, USA

Website: http://kikiontheriver.com

Fine dining restaurant with modern Greek food and authentic Mediterranean island-inspired riverfront setting. Visit the Greek restaurant on Miami River that leaves people breathless.

0 favorite snippets

View their snippets

kikiontheriver's Favorite Snippets



« Prev 1 Next »
« Prev 1 Next »